The adventure begins in Brackenford's village square during a light rain. The old shrine bell rings once despite the tower being visibly empty. Reeve Elda Marris explains that Tamsin disappeared after following blue light into a sealed stairwell, while Perrin Holt points out fresh wet footprints leading from the shrine to a locked maintenance door. Elda offers payment, food, and the village's gratitude, but warns that the next midnight bell is only a few hours away.
Elda Marris
Elda Marris approaches the characters in the village square after the empty bell tower rings. She is practical, exhausted, and visibly frightened, but refuses to leave the village while Tamsin remains below the shrine.

If Tamsin remains below the shrine until the next midnight bell, the Drowned Cantor will bind her as the new keeper of the aqueduct. The rising water will then burst through Brackenford's lower streets, damaging homes and contaminating the wells. Success saves Tamsin and gives the village a chance to restore or safely retire the ancient waterworks.
Background Lore
For generations, the hill village of Brackenford has relied on the old bell tower at Saint Orra's Shrine to warn of floods, fires, and raids. Three nights ago, the shrine's young bellkeeper, Tamsin Vale, vanished while investigating a strange blue light beneath the tower. Since then, the bell has rung once at midnight each night, though no one is inside. The village council fears Tamsin is trapped in the abandoned aqueduct tunnels beneath the shrine.
